Nakiska
(Attractions & Activities - Skiing)
Hwy 40, Kananaskis  T0L 2H0 • 403-591-7777 • 800-258-7669
Distance: ~39.162 km from The Fairmont Banff Springs
Description: Designed and built for the 1988 Winter Olympics, this resort has adapted itself to general usage and welcomes both novice and accomplished skiers. 70% of the terrain is considered intermediate in class; most of this falls mid-range on the mountain, with expert above and beginner below. A total of 28 runs comprise the resort, and 5 chair lifts easily handle slope traffic. Snow-making facilities cover 85% of the runs, and grooming is a high priority. Snowboarders are accommodated along the slopes, and 35 acres of gladed runs take care of those who want more challenging terrain.
